Mark Jackson nearly lost the Warriors game 1 with his Klay Thomson post ups. I understand he likes to exploit match ups but posting up Klay thomson on almost every possession in the 4th quarter is hurting our team on offense and that is why we gave up that 11 point lead. It takes the ball out of Curry's hands, it ruins our ball movement, and it takes away the Curry and Lee pick and roll which is very effective for us. Curry was almost nonexistent in the final quarter because of the Thomson post ups.
